Windows啟動MySQL服務詳解

MySQL是一個開源的關係型資料庫管理系統,被廣泛應用於Web開發,與PHP、Java等編程語言配合使用。在Windows系統中,啟動MySQL服務是使用MySQL資料庫的前提。本文將從多個方面詳解如何啟動MySQL服務,同時對於啟動MySQL服務中出現的問題提供解決方案。

一、Windows啟動MySQL服務命令

Windows啟動MySQL服務的命令可以通過圖形用戶界面(GUI)和命令行界面(CLI)兩種方式進行操作。

GUI方式:通過「服務」功能啟動MySQL服務

步驟如下:

1. 打開「控制面板」。
2. 點擊「管理工具」,進入「計算機管理」。
3. 在左側的「服務和應用程序」下面找到「服務」,雙擊進入。
4. 找到MySQL服務,在服務名字右側有啟動、停止、重啟等操作按鈕,點擊啟動按鈕即可。

CLI方式:通過命令行啟動MySQL服務

步驟如下:

1. 打開命令提示符(CMD)。
2. 進入MySQL安裝目錄中的bin目錄下,例如:cd C:\Program Files\MySQL\MySQL Server 8.0\bin。
3. 執行以下命令:net start mysql。

二、Windows啟動MySQL服務失敗

在啟動MySQL服務時,可能會遇到以下錯誤:

1. Windows啟動MySQL服務報錯1053

該錯誤通常是由於啟動服務超時引起的。

解決方法如下:

1. 打開「計算機管理」。
2. 在左側的「服務和應用程序」下面找到「服務」,找到MySQL服務,單擊右鍵「屬性」。
3. 在彈出的屬性窗口中,找到「服務」選項卡,將「啟動類型」改成「手動」,並點擊「應用」按鈕。
4. 之後再單擊右鍵MySQL服務,選擇「啟動」。MySQL服務應該能正常啟動。
5. 啟動成功後再次回到「服務」選項卡中,將啟動類型改回「自動」,並點擊「應用」按鈕。

2. Windows啟動MySQL服務名無效

該錯誤通常是由於MySQL服務名錯誤或不存在引起的。

解決方法如下:

1. 打開「計算機管理」。
2. 在左側的「服務和應用程序」下面找到「服務」,檢查MySQL服務的名稱是否正確並且服務是否存在。
3. 如果服務存在且名稱正確,可以嘗試通過右鍵單擊MySQL服務進行「重命名」,然後再進行啟動嘗試。
4. 如果服務不存在,可能需要重新安裝MySQL。

3. Windows啟動後黑屏

這種情況可能是MySQL服務正在運行,但是沒有正確啟動或關閉,導致無法正常使用MySQL。

解決方法如下:

1. 打開任務管理器。
2. 在「進程」選項卡中查找「mysqld.exe」進程,單擊右鍵結束該進程。
3. 重新啟動MySQL服務即可。

三、服務裡面的MySQL啟動不了

在「服務」裡面啟動MySQL服務時,可能會遇到無法啟動的問題。

1. 無法啟動MySQL服務

該錯誤通常是由於埠被佔用或者數據目錄許可權錯誤引起的。

解決方法如下:

1. 檢查MySQL使用的埠是否被佔用。可以通過命令「netstat -ano」查看當前所有進程的埠佔用情況。
2. 如果埠被佔用,可以嘗試修改MySQL使用的埠號(需要同時修改配置文件my.ini)。
3. 檢查MySQL的數據目錄許可權是否正確。如果數據目錄不可寫許可權會導致MySQL無法啟動。

2. 啟動不了MySQL服務,找不到

該錯誤通常是由於MySQL服務未安裝或者未正確安裝引起的。

解決方法如下:

1. 檢查MySQL服務是否已經安裝。
2. 如果MySQL服務已經安裝,可以嘗試重新安裝MySQL。
3. 重新安裝MySQL時,需要注意許可權問題及操作系統對MySQL的支持情況

3. cmd命令啟動MySQL服務

在命令行界面下啟動MySQL服務對於有些人會更為方便。

啟動方法如下:

1. 打開命令提示符(CMD)。
2. 進入MySQL安裝目錄中的bin目錄下,例如:cd C:\Program Files\MySQL\MySQL Server 8.0\bin。
3. 執行以下命令:net start mysql。

總結

本文從GUI和CLI兩個方面詳細介紹了Windows啟動MySQL服務的命令和解決啟動錯誤的方法。讀者可以根據自己的具體情況選擇最適合自己的方法來啟動MySQL服務,以保證能夠順利使用MySQL。

原創文章,作者:小藍,如若轉載,請註明出處:https://www.506064.com/zh-tw/n/248969.html

(0)
打賞 微信掃一掃 微信掃一掃 支付寶掃一掃 支付寶掃一掃
小藍的頭像小藍
上一篇 2024-12-12 13:30
下一篇 2024-12-12 13:30

相關推薦

  • 如何修改mysql的埠號

    本文將介紹如何修改mysql的埠號,方便開發者根據實際需求配置對應埠號。 一、為什麼需要修改mysql埠號 默認情況下,mysql使用的埠號是3306。在某些情況下,我們需…

    編程 2025-04-29
  • 如何在樹莓派上安裝Windows 7系統?

    隨著樹莓派的普及,許多用戶想在樹莓派上安裝Windows 7操作系統。 一、準備工作 在開始之前,需要準備以下材料: 1.樹莓派4B一台; 2.一張8GB以上的SD卡; 3.下載並…

    編程 2025-04-29
  • 如何配置Python環境變數在Windows 11

    在本文中,您將學習如何在Windows 11操作系統上配置Python環境變數的步驟。Python是一種高級編程語言,廣泛用於編寫Web應用程序、數據分析、人工智慧和機器學習等。在…

    編程 2025-04-29
  • Python操作MySQL

    本文將從以下幾個方面對Python操作MySQL進行詳細闡述: 一、連接MySQL資料庫 在使用Python操作MySQL之前,我們需要先連接MySQL資料庫。在Python中,我…

    編程 2025-04-29
  • MySQL遞歸函數的用法

    本文將從多個方面對MySQL遞歸函數的用法做詳細的闡述,包括函數的定義、使用方法、示例及注意事項。 一、遞歸函數的定義 遞歸函數是指在函數內部調用自身的函數。MySQL提供了CRE…

    編程 2025-04-29
  • MySQL bigint與long的區別

    本文將從數據類型定義、存儲空間、數據範圍、計算效率、應用場景五個方面詳細闡述MySQL bigint與long的區別。 一、數據類型定義 bigint在MySQL中是一種有符號的整…

    編程 2025-04-28
  • MySQL左連接索引不生效問題解決

    在MySQL資料庫中,經常會使用左連接查詢操作,但是左連接查詢中索引不生效的情況也比較常見。本文將從多個方面探討MySQL左連接索引不生效問題,並給出相應的解決方法。 一、索引的作…

    編程 2025-04-28
  • 如何在Windows系統下載和使用cygwin?

    如果你是一名Windows系統的開發者,你可能會遇到一個問題,那就是缺少Unix/Linux系統下常用的命令行工具,這時候,你可以使用cygwin來解決這個問題。 一、cygwin…

    編程 2025-04-27
  • 蘋果電腦安裝Windows教程

    下面將介紹如何在蘋果電腦上安裝Windows操作系統。 一、獲取Windows操作系統鏡像文件 首先,我們需要去Microsoft官網下載Windows操作系統的鏡像文件。 步驟:…

    編程 2025-04-27
  • CentOS 7在線安裝MySQL 8

    在本文中,我們將介紹如何在CentOS 7操作系統中在線安裝MySQL 8。我們會從安裝環境的準備開始,到安裝MySQL 8的過程進行詳細的闡述。 一、環境準備 在進行MySQL …

    編程 2025-04-27

發表回復

登錄後才能評論